Output 40116775776bfc5dc8efadf01721342699b58c35206c31909905605a94cacc95:0

value
123908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bce695baa16959c55c991f1d779e5dcbfc39feb OP_EQUAL
address
3ESF7w9jPywro1Zn9WjEjept81VtwVFqwq
transaction
40116775776bfc5dc8efadf01721342699b58c35206c31909905605a94cacc95
spent
true